Output 35784dec1c723f0fb7f03b8c76cfe1f1d89a191fb9f1a12ed80475fc52918917:1

value
18430126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894577f8de6c56e02046c18d5b45fb84261e26bd OP_EQUAL
address
3ECqibC86iaunBdFTdkU99pRTvTWT8hrRt
transaction
35784dec1c723f0fb7f03b8c76cfe1f1d89a191fb9f1a12ed80475fc52918917
confirmations
356776
spent
true